What effect did the crusades have on the byzantine empire

In general terms, the Crusades affected the Byzantine empire negatively. for one thing, the marches of the crusader armies through Byzantine territory typically led to destruction and disorder if but rarely on a grade scale.

Define "paranoia." How was the paranoia of the 20s expressed? How was it related to isolationism?
elixir [45]

Paranoia refers to a feeling that can exist in humans and which is heavily influenced by anxiety or by fear. People who suffer from this often feel themselves to be persecuted, or hated and threatened by everyone. These people might also believe in conspiracies, which can result in irrational fear.

During the 1920s, the country experienced a period of paranoia. The trauma of World War I was fresh in people's minds, and many were fearful of ever being threatened in such a way again. This led to a strong fear of the "other." This was expressed in practices such as increased racism (ex. the rise of the Ku Klux Klan) or political intolerance (ex. the Red Scare against communists). This was also expressed through isolationism, as many people believed that by keeping the country free of foreign influence, they would be less threatened by dangerous foreign forces, such as communism.
